全球旋轉閥市場預計將從 2025 年的 6.3243 億美元成長到 2030 年的 7.96189 億美元,複合年成長率為 4.71%。

旋轉閥市場正經歷顯著擴張,主要受關鍵工業領域對節能和精密物料輸送方案需求的推動。主要市場趨勢包括:化學工業為提高製程效率而日益廣泛地採用旋轉閥;製藥業為實現精密物料輸送不斷成長的應用;印度因其工業應用的不斷拓展而崛起為主要市場;以及政府投資的增加推動了鋼鐵生產等行業的需求。此外,對節能產品的需求不斷成長以及政府在關鍵領域的持續投入也支撐了市場成長。

市場成長促進因素

旋轉閥市場的主要成長要素來自全球工產業的強勁發展。旋轉閥作為控制閥、密封件和製程流體安全裝置,在化學工業中扮演著至關重要的角色。其多功能性體現在能夠在各種壓力水平下實現無洩漏流量調節。具體應用包括將旋轉式氣鎖閥用作化學製程的混合容器,有助於將反應維持在適當的壓力和溫度下。化學工業在推動國民經濟成長方面發揮著舉足輕重的作用,這也凸顯了其作為旋轉閥等工業部件主要消費群體的重要地位。該行業的持續成長和產量不斷推高了對這些閥門的需求,而這些閥門對於安全高效的化學生產流程至關重要。

同時,製藥業日益成長的需求正在推動旋轉閥市場的發展。在製藥生產中,旋轉閥對於控制和停止可流動產品的流動至關重要。它們能夠以高精度連續輸送粉末、顆粒和其他散裝物料,這對於製藥生產中精確的劑量控制至關重要。製藥業產能的擴張預計將成為推動專用旋轉閥需求的關鍵因素。為此,主要市場參與者正在開發和推出專為這種嚴苛環境而設計的產品。其中包括與製藥業合作開發的超衛生旋轉閥,以確保其適用於各種應用。其他產品則旨在謹慎可靠地處理諸如藥品成分和化妝品等敏感物料,從而確保產品在整個生產過程中的完整性。

地理視野:印度作為新興市場

印度旋轉閥市場預計將顯著成長,該國正努力成為領先的區域市場。食品飲料和製藥等關鍵終端用戶產業的強勁成長將支撐這一預期擴張。例如,製藥業正吸引大量外國直接投資,這表明其擁有強大的成長潛力,並正在建立需要先進物料輸送設備的產業基礎。

此外,政府積極推動工業發展,為旋轉閥市場創造了有利環境。旋轉閥在確保煉鋼等關鍵工業流程的持續運作中發揮著至關重要的作用。政府推出的各項舉措,包括針對特種鋼的績效獎勵計劃,旨在鼓勵對國內鋼鐵業進行大規模投資和產能建設。這些投資將直接提升生產設施對工業閥門的需求。此外,無機化工等基礎設施行業的產量不斷成長,表明旋轉閥的應用領域正在擴大,以提高製程安全性並在各種壓力水平下實現密封控制。蓬勃發展的工業部門和政府的支持性政策相結合,預計將推動旋轉閥的銷售,並顯著促進國內市場的成長。

這些因素,即全球化工和製藥業的強勁表現,以及印度等新興經濟體充滿活力的工業成長和政策支持,為旋轉閥市場描繪了一幅積極的圖景,預計該市場將繼續擴張。

Global Rotary Valve Market is expected to grow at a 4.71% CAGR, reaching USD 796.189 million by 2030 from USD 632.430 million in 2025.

The rotary valve market is experiencing significant expansion, driven by demand for energy-efficient and precise material handling solutions across core industrial sectors. Key market highlights include increasing adoption within the chemical industry for enhanced process efficiency, growing utilization in the pharmaceutical sector for precise material handling, the emergence of India as a key market with expanding industrial applications, and advancing government investments fueling demand in areas such as steel production. The market's growth is further supported by rising demand for energy-efficient products and sustained government expenditure in critical sectors.

Market Growth Drivers

A primary driver for the rotary valve market is the bolstering growth of the global chemical sector. Rotary valves serve as essential components in this industry, functioning as control valves, seals, and a method for ensuring process fluid safety. Their versatility is demonstrated by their ability to enable leak-free flow rate adjustment across various pressure levels. Specific applications include using a rotary airlock valve as a mixing vessel for chemical processes, which aids in maintaining reactions at the correct pressure and temperature. The essential nature of the chemical sector to national economic expansion underscores its significant role as a consumer of industrial components like rotary valves. The ongoing growth and output of this sector consistently bolster the demand for these valves, as they are integral to safe and efficient chemical manufacturing processes.

Concurrently, the rotary valve market is being propelled by growing demand from the pharmaceutical sector. In pharmaceutical manufacturing, rotary valves are critical for controlling and halting the flow of free-flowing products. They enable the continuous feeding of powders, granulates, and other bulk materials with a high degree of precision, which is paramount for accurate dosage in drug production. The expanding output of the pharmaceutical industry is a key factor predicted to spur the demand for specialized rotary valves. In response, key market players have developed and introduced products specifically designed for this demanding environment. These include hyper-hygienic rotary valves featuring fully manufactured designs developed in collaboration with the pharmaceutical industry to ensure suitability for intended use. Other product offerings are engineered to handle sensitive materials, such as pharmaceutical components and cosmetics, with high levels of care and dependability, ensuring product integrity throughout the manufacturing process.

Geographical Outlook: India as an Emerging Market

The rotary valve market in India is poised to show significant growth, establishing the country as a key geographical segment. This anticipated expansion is underpinned by bolstering growth in major end-user industries, particularly food and beverages and pharmaceuticals. The pharmaceutical sector, for instance, has seen substantial foreign direct investment inflows, indicating strong growth potential and industrial capacity building that will require advanced material handling equipment.

Furthermore, positive government intervention in industrial development is creating a favorable environment for the rotary valve market. These components play a vital role in ensuring the uninterrupted operation of key industrial processes, such as steel-making. Government initiatives, including performance-linked incentive schemes for specialty steel, are designed to promote significant investment and capacity building within the domestic steel industry. Such investments directly fuel the demand for industrial valves used in production facilities. Additionally, increased production outputs in foundational sectors like inorganic chemicals highlight a growing industrial base where rotary valves are applied to enhance process safety and provide leak-free regulation at different pressure levels. The combination of a thriving industrial sector and supportive government policies is expected to accelerate the sales of rotary valves, thereby driving substantial market growth within the country.

The convergence of these factors-strong performance in the chemical and pharmaceutical sectors globally, coupled with the dynamic industrial growth and policy support in emerging economies like India-paints a positive outlook for the rotary valve market, positioning it for continued expansion.
